Block

#18,653,304
Block Number
18,653,304 @ 05/24/2024, 15:29:00
Status
Finalized
ID
0x011ca0789d80ba46133d857d50f7dc67679ca25cd7e8f42a6ce7e7c1aa7d9c0e
Transactions
Gas Used
0/39960938 (0.00% Used)
Total Score
155,697,026 (+14)
Rewards
0.00 VTHO